COMP 314

Object Oriented Design and Programming (BTACS, Major) (4,1,0)(L) 3 credits

This course will introduce students to object oriented design and programming. Upon completion, students should have a good understanding of object oriented design and programming including understanding and developing console based applications in C++, Visual C++ applications, Visual Basic .Net and an introduction to Microsoft Foundation Classes (MFC) and inter-object communication. Students will be able to design and develop systems using object-oriented design and programming methodologies in console and Windows based applications. They will also have an introductory knowledge base in MFC such that they can analyze and use these library functions in application development.

Prerequisite: COMP 123

Corequisite: COMP 223